[Uses]

[1R-[1α(R*),2β]]-α-Methoxy-benzeneacetic Acid 1,2,3,4-Tetrahydro-7-Methoxy-2-[(1-oxopropyl)aMino]-1-naphthalenyl Ester is used in the preparation of Hexahydronaphthoxazines, a new class of dopamine agonists.
